Texas 2021 - 87th 2nd C.S.

Texas House Bill HR82

Caption

Commending Michael Nguyen on his service as a legislative intern in the office of State Representative Jacey Jetton.

Impact

The resolution recognizes not only Mr. Nguyen's personal achievements, including his status as a National Merit Scholar and leadership roles within his school and community, but also aims to encourage other young individuals to engage in civic activities and consider pursuing careers in public service. This acknowledgment reflects a commitment to fostering youth leadership and mentorship within the legislative framework, ensuring that future generations are prepared to take on roles in government and community leadership.

Summary

House Resolution 82 commends Michael Nguyen for his exemplary service as a legislative intern in the office of State Representative Jacey Jetton during the summer of 2021.Throughout his internship, Mr. Nguyen demonstrated exceptional dedication and skill in assisting with a variety of legislative tasks, while also gaining insights into the legislative process and the challenges faced by Texas citizens. His accomplishments were highlighted as contributions to both the legislative office and the broader community, underscoring the importance of youth involvement in public service.
